Recipe View 5 mins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Line a large roasting pan with parchment paper for easy cleanup. (5 minutes)

Image Step 02
02 Step

Recipe View 2 mins In a large bowl, whisk together the melted butter, maple syrup, sea salt, and freshly ground black pepper until well combined. (2 minutes)

Image Step 03
03 Step

Recipe View 5 mins Add the butternut squash, turnips, parsnips, sweet potato, rutabaga, and carrots to the bowl. Toss gently but thoroughly to ensure all vegetables are evenly coated with the maple-butter glaze. (5 minutes)

Image Step 04
04 Step

Recipe View 3 mins Spread the coated vegetables in a single layer in the prepared roasting pan. (3 minutes)

Image Step 05
05 Step

Recipe View 30 mins Bake in the preheated oven for approximately 30 minutes, or until the vegetables are tender and slightly caramelized, turning halfway through for even browning. (30 minutes)

Image Step 06
06 Step

Recipe View Remove from the oven and let cool slightly before serving. Garnish with fresh herbs, if desired.

For a deeper caramelization, increase the oven temperature to 400°F for the last 10 minutes of cooking.
Feel free to add other root vegetables like beets or celery root to the mix.
A sprinkle of chopped pecans or walnuts adds a delightful crunch.
Consider adding a pinch of cayenne pepper for a touch of heat.
These roasted vegetables are delicious served warm or at room temperature.
